class Role < ApplicationRecord
extend Pagination::Model
# Built-in roles
NON_BUILTIN = 0
BUILTIN_NON_MEMBER = 1
BUILTIN_ANONYMOUS = 2
scope :builtin, ->(*args) {
compare = 'not' if args.first == true
where("#{compare} builtin = #{NON_BUILTIN}")
}
before_destroy :check_deletable
has_many :workflows, dependent: :delete_all do
def copy_from_role(source_role)
Workflow.copy(nil, source_role, nil, proxy_association.owner)
end
end
has_many :member_roles, dependent: :destroy
has_many :members, through: :member_roles
has_many :role_permissions, dependent: :destroy
default_scope -> {
includes(:role_permissions)
}
acts_as_list
validates :name,
presence: true,
length: { maximum: 30 },
uniqueness: { case_sensitive: true }
def self.givable
where(builtin: NON_BUILTIN)
.where(type: 'Role')
.order(Arel.sql('position'))
end
def permissions
# prefer map over pluck as we will probably always load
# the permissions anyway
role_permissions.map(&:permission).map(&:to_sym)
end
def permissions=(perms)
not_included_yet = (perms.map(&:to_sym) - permissions).reject(&:blank?)
included_until_now = permissions - perms.map(&:to_sym)
remove_permission!(*included_until_now)
add_permission!(*not_included_yet)
end
def add_permission!(*perms)
perms.each do |perm|
add_permission(perm)
end
end
def remove_permission!(*perms)
return unless permissions.is_a?(Array)
perms = perms.map(&:to_s)
self.role_permissions = role_permissions.reject do |rp|
perms.include?(rp.permission)
end
end
# Returns true if the role has the given permission
def has_permission?(perm)
!permissions.nil? && permissions.include?(perm.to_sym)
end
def <=>(other)
other ? position <=> other.position : -1
end
def to_s
name
end
# Return true if the role is a builtin role
def builtin?
builtin != NON_BUILTIN
end
# Return true if the role is a project member role
def member?
!builtin?
end
# Return true if role is allowed to do the specified action
# action can be:
# * a parameter-like Hash (eg. controller: '/projects', action: 'edit')
# * a permission Symbol (eg. :edit_project)
def allowed_to?(action)
if action.is_a? Hash
allowed_actions.include? "#{action[:controller]}/#{action[:action]}"
else
allowed_permissions.include? action
end
end
# Return the builtin 'non member' role. If the role doesn't exist,
# it will be created on the fly.
def self.non_member
non_member_role = where(builtin: BUILTIN_NON_MEMBER).first
if non_member_role.nil?
non_member_role = create(name: 'Non member', position: 0) do |role|
role.builtin = BUILTIN_NON_MEMBER
end
raise 'Unable to create the non-member role.' if non_member_role.new_record?
end
non_member_role
end
# Return the builtin 'anonymous' role. If the role doesn't exist,
# it will be created on the fly.
def self.anonymous
anonymous_role = where(builtin: BUILTIN_ANONYMOUS).first
if anonymous_role.nil?
anonymous_role = create(name: 'Anonymous', position: 0) do |role|
role.builtin = BUILTIN_ANONYMOUS
end
raise 'Unable to create the anonymous role.' if anonymous_role.new_record?
end
anonymous_role
end
def self.by_permission(permission)
all.select do |role|
role.allowed_to? permission
end
end
def self.paginated_search(search, options = {})
paginate_scope! givable.like(search), options
end
def self.in_new_project
givable
.except(:order)
.order(Arel.sql("COALESCE(#{Setting.new_project_user_role_id.to_i} = id, false) DESC, position"))
.first
end
private
def allowed_permissions
@allowed_permissions ||= permissions + OpenProject::AccessControl.public_permissions.map(&:name)
end
def allowed_actions
@actions_allowed ||= allowed_permissions.map do |permission|
OpenProject::AccessControl.allowed_actions(permission)
end.flatten
end
def check_deletable
raise "Can't delete role" if members.any?
raise "Can't delete builtin role" if builtin?
end
def add_permission(permission)
if persisted?
role_permissions.create(permission:)
else
role_permissions.build(permission:)
end
end
end
